Mosquitoes with West Nile Virus were confirmed August 8 in a surveillance trap set August 1 by CMMCP in the northern part of town. Working with the Worcester Department of Health, truck-mounted Ultra-Low Volume (ULV) sprayingwas done in the area below on August 14 after sunset.

Catch basins were treated in this area in this area to stop emergence of mosquito species that can carry WNV, and additional surveillance traps have been set up to gauge population density and determine if additional virus can be isolated.

It’s important to note that spraying can only reduce but not eliminate the threat of mosquito-borne illness in the areas that are sprayed. That’s why it’s important for individuals to continue to take personal precautions against mosquito bites — both before and after any spraying is conducted.
